Transaction 283e503c21ce8ddddb60c30bed5344af53588171321b9be643be0f6e0a377f65
1 Input
1 Output
-
283e503c21ce8ddddb60c30bed5344af53588171321b9be643be0f6e0a377f65:0
- value
- 1829281
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ba5bc6fb013b5ad9c241e30c7404e4258f8f67e OP_EQUAL
- address
- 3CxoagbkZNAxqFpUW69z4NRgKRheqrVdTQ